For years, the internet has buzzed with a specific rumor, claiming that some flavorings are sourced from beaver anal glands. The question, "Do natural flavors come from beavers?" arises from the historical use of a substance called castoreum, which is now almost entirely absent from modern food production. This persistent myth stems from real, albeit outdated, practices and a misunderstanding of how flavor compounds are created today.

Despite a widespread rumor suggesting otherwise, virtually all vanilla extract available today is completely vegan. The long-standing misconception about vanilla extract not being vegan originates from misinformation regarding a rare, animal-derived flavoring agent that is not used in modern commercial vanilla production.
